In other words, the adhesive breaks down over time due to the environmental conditions. This is especially true if the sticky notes are exposed to high temperatures, direct sunlight, or high humidity. To pin a sticky note on Mac, open the Stickies application, right-click on the note you want to pin, and select the “Pin” option. You can unpin the sticky note at any time by right-clicking on the note again and selecting “Unpin. Sticky notes curl up because they contain a type of adhesive that causes them to cling to any surface but also reacts to the moisture and humidity in the air. This reaction causes oxidation to occur, causing the adhesive on the sticky side of the note to become more brittle and thus more prone to curling up. The all-new app, which helps users organize and visually lay out content on an "infinite canvas," is available after updating to iOS and iPadOS 16.2 or macOS 13.1. As part of its latest OS update, Apple launched Freeform, an app that serves as a digital whiteboard for up to 100 collaborators. The iOS 16.2 update is rolling out to all users with iPhone 8 or above, starting today. Products in the digital whiteboard space are pretty valuable. Last month, Adobe acquired Figma for a whopping $20 billion.

Sticky Widgets enables placing sticky note-style widgets on your iPhone or iPad Home Screen which can be modified simply by tapping on the widget. It’s utility that’s such an obvious fit for widgets, I’m surprised I haven’t seen a hundred other apps doing the same thing. If you’re anything like me, the steady stream of apps adding support for iOS 14 widgets have put your Home Screen in a constant state of flux. The latest app continuing that trend is Sticky Widgets.
